Refurbishing the "Pink Panther" 868-4 from 2011
This rod has been one of my favorite rods, built back in August 2011. I caught some very nice striped bass on it. It needed its single foot guides replaced. The Fuji strippers were OK and also the tip top, so I left those unchanged, but rewrapped them. I put Pac Bay Minima single foots, so hopefully...

Fresh off the bench...the black rod! The blank was made by CD rods. Stealthy looking streamer rod, medium fast action, syncork grip, Fuji seat, Pac Bay TiCH guides. Built for rugged use in saltwater. It will make a nice sight-casting fly rod for schoolie stripers near my house.
